iPad Challenge – Marketer to Run Business on iPad Only for 30 Days

Sometimes marketing can be full of hype, sometime gimmicky, and sometimes a mixture of both.  What Apple has done with the iPad remains to be seen.  Certainly there has been a lot of Buzz since the January announcement.  One person is compelled enough that he has actually decided to run his business exclusively off the iPad for 30 days.  With the idea that the iPad’s lack of multi-tasking capabilities will increase productivity, new media icon Paul Colligan has decided to launch the 30 day experiment as soon as he gets his device.
